Learn About Out-of-Band Storage Arrays

An out-of-band is one that is managed from the over the network through each RAID controller module's Ethernet connection.

To manage an out-of-band storage array, attach cables from the network to each RAID controller module's Ethernet connection in the storage array. Next, define each RAID controller module's IP address or name. Then, select Edit >> Add Storage Array or Tools >> Automatic Discovery to add the storage array to the window.

The out-of-band management method is in contrast to the in-band method. The in-band method enables you to manage the storage array from your storage management station through the host's network connection and then through its I/O connection to the storage array. The host must be running the host-agent management software.

You can manage a storage array using one or both types of network management connections (in-band or out-of-band). The will display the appropriate management connections in its Tree view and Table view.
